Consider updating the IKELOS sets

Don't post super often, but I thought I'd jump on during this season to offer a bit of feedback on my favorite set of armor and weapons. Bungie, consider giving the IKELOS armor access to the warmind mods and granting IKELOS weapons the same benefits as the Seraph weapons. Aesthetically, I love the IKELOS armor and weapons. And I would say the weapons still have some viable perk options in the newer sandboxes despite being fixed. It would be cool if IKELOS armor could take on mods allowing for the generation of warmind cells, and if the weapons from the set could do the same as the Seraph ones. I don't think weapon rolls would even need to be reworked! In lieu of the potential of weapon retirement, I would love it if those four weapons could remain relevant!

    • Okay, consider this: the IKELOS Shotgun and Sniper had their previously unique perks nerfed, and then extended to many other weapons. The IKELOS smg is in the much the same scenario, except it's unique perk was just garbage to begin with. What if the perks on the Shotgun and Sniper were returned to their pre-nerf states, while the SMG gains a new (but similar) perk that grants a better reward upon busting an enemy shield. Maybe just give it "Ikelos Armaments" and have it refill your grenade energy whenever you destroy a shield with the SMG weapon (combing Demolitionist and the Armament mods).
